| Re:How to have a fullscreen fb ? 4 Years, 7 Months ago |
|
[quote]but how i disable the rest of the template only during the forum page??[/quote]
You need to go in the backend of the site under the module manager and select each of the modules which are showing up on your template when you viewing your forum and make their view options to not include when the forum link is being used.
You may have issues with your template as some templates don\'t allow different modules to be hidden at all (most often the \'left\' position). In that case you\'ll have to edit your template to make the problem positions optional.

| Re:fireboard, full width. 4 Years, 7 Months ago |
|
[quote]
argg i must edit the template??[/quote]
Possibly
[quote]
how i load a full width fireboard???[/quote]
It looks like you\'ve got your modules showing up correctly (as in not at all). It means the template you are using doesn\'t collapse the left column at all.
[quote]
which joomla templates are full width compatible???[/quote]
By the looks of it none of the default ones are. There are ones at the various template clubs which do have removable left columns. Otherwise it\'s usually very easy to [url=http://forum.joomla.org/index.php/topic,188003.0.html]edit the template[/url] to get rid of the left column.
